14.4.2
I/O status information
The bit-coded wIOState status signal serves to transfer the status the safe inputs and the safe
output:
[14-2] Bit coding of the wIOState status signal
14.4.3
Control information
The bit coded wControl control signal serves to transfer information about requested or active
safety functions. The application in the controller must evaluate the control signal and carry out the
corresponding action.
• It is possible to request/activate several safety functions at the same time.
[14-3] Bit coding of the wControl control signal
Bit
Name
Meaning
0 SD-In1
Sensor input 1 in ON state.
1 SD-In2
Sensor input 2 in ON state.
5 AIS
Restart acknowledgement via terminal effected (negative edge: 10).
6 AIE
Error acknowledgement via terminal effected (negative edge: 10).
8 PS_AIS
Restart acknowledgement via safety bus effected (positive edge: 01)
9 PS_AIE
Error acknowledgement via safety bus effected (positive edge: 01)
Bits not listed are reserved for future extensions!
Bit
Name
Meaning
0 SS1 active
Safe stop 1 (SS1) is active.
2 ES active
Enable switch (ES) for motion functions in special operations is active.
3 OMS
Operation mode selector (OMS) for special operations is requested.
4 SSE active
Emergency stop function (SSE) is active.
• At the end of the function, bit 1 (SS1 active) or bit 0 of the status signal
SMI_wState (STO active) is set according to the emergency stop function
parameterised.
5
OMS active
Special operation is active.
Bits not listed are reserved for future extensions!
Note!
The application in the controller must evaluate the control signal wControl and carry out
the corresponding action. The execution of the corresponding action (e.g. braking to
standstill) requires an appropriate application interconnection which must be provided
by the operator!
